Refined RIP-seq protocol for epitranscriptome analysis with low input materials
N6-Methyladenosine (m(6)A) accounts for approximately 0.2% to 0.6% of all adenosine in mammalian mRNA, representing the most abundant internal mRNA modifications. m(6)A RNA immunoprecipitation followed by high-throughput sequencing (MeRIP-seq) is a powerful technique to map the m(6)A location transc...
